Arsenal 'join race to sign Nemanja Matic'

Arsenal become the latest club to be linked with a bid for Benfica's Nemanja Matic.

Arsenal have reportedly joined Chelsea, Manchester City, Manchester United and Real Madrid in the race to secure the services of Benfica star Nemanja Matic.

The Gunners have been in touch with the midfielder's agent Dejan Mitrovic about a potential move to the Emirates Stadium, according to talkSPORT.

Matic is no stranger to the Premier League, having played at Chelsea earlier in his career before moving to Portugal in a deal that saw David Luiz head in the opposite direction.

The news follows reports linking Arsenal with a move for Fulham striker Dimitar Berbatov.
